Building Permits

Building permits are required to assure compliance with health and life safety building codes and protect your family and property. Most home improvement projects require a permit before work begins. Permits are not required for cosmetic improvements such as removal and replacement window, siding, roof shingles, painting, flooring, tiling, trim work, changing out cabinetry, and replacing electrical and plumbing fixtures in the same location. Non-structural repairs to interior surfaces don't require permits provided no changes are made to the structural framing, electrical, or plumbing. Emergency repairs may be addressed without immediately obtaining a permit, but the permit must be applied for within 7 days of the emergency repair work being performed.

Application Process

All applicants are encouraged to submit permit applications and construction documents via the City's web portal. Submitting applications and construction documents digitally will allow the City to serve our customers more efficiently. Design professionals can provide digital plans for submittal, if necessary. For smaller projects, plans printed on 8 1/2x11 or 11x17, visit the Community Development Department and staff will be available to assist you. 

Once your application is processed and approved, you will receive an email which will include an invoice and information on how to pay for and obtain your permit.

Standard lead times for issuance of permits are:

  • Commercial and industrial projects: 3 to 4 weeks
  • Residential projects: 2 to 3 weeks
  • All other permits: 5 to 7 business days

Scheduling Inspections

Call 815-895-4434 a minimum of one day before the desired inspection date during normal business hours. Provide the permit number, job address, name and phone number to secure a date and time on the inspection schedule. If calling during normal business hours and you receive a voicemail, please leave your name and phone number and your call will be returned as soon as available. Inspection requests left on the voicemail before 7 am and after 3 pm will not be honored.
